Methods of stimulating motion
Illustrate the different methods of stimulating motion?
Expert
The different methods of stimulating motion are as follows:
(i). Zero Acceleration or Constant Speed:
Here the time spacing for the in betweens frames is at equivalent interval that is, when we want n in between frames for key frames at time Ta & Tb, then the time interval among key frames is divided into n+1 sub-intervals leading to in among spacing of T specified by the expression:
T = (Tb – Ta) / (N + 1)(ii). Non Zero Accelerations:
This method of simulating the motion is fairly useful introducing the realistic displays of speed changes, specifically at the initially and completion of motion sequence. To establish the model and slow down portion of an animation path, we employ splines or trigonometric functions.
